A car dealership is going to give you anywhere from 2,500-5,000 less than what they intend to sell them for...

I work for a dealership and thats what we do... the thing you get in the mail is a promotion... the company that sends you that gets paid per how many people visit or call on that ad... you make the dealership money just by going in there and talking to them
